As Paul will want to get to know you (and your mouth), your initial consultation will be slightly longer than a normal check-up. During this extended appointment, he will:
Discuss your expectations, your requirements and any of your concerns
Find out about your past dental experiences
Undertake a full examination of your teeth and gums, including screening for oral cancer
Take dental x-rays, if necessary
Following this thorough examination, he will discuss:
Your short and long term care options
How you can pay for treatment and care

As well as your regular dental visit, hygiene appointments should also be an essential part of your dental care. Our Hygienists are qualified members of the dental team who focus on preventing and treating gum disease by promoting good oral hygiene.
Gum disease causes inflammation of the tissue that surrounds teeth and, if not treated, it can lead to recession of the gums. This can cause pockets to develop as the gum moves away from the tooth and can eventually lead to loosening of the teeth. The cleaner your teeth, the less likely you are to develop gum disease. Our hygienist will not only thoroughly clean your teeth but will also show you how to keep up the good work at home.
